At the University of Missouri-Kansas City (UMKC), the path to discovery takes several forms: basic bench science, translational research, clinical research, health outcomes research and the technology that enables and advances scientists' work. The next generation of health practitioners and scientists educated at UMKC benefit from the innovative learning and research environment provided by the University and its clinical and research partners.
